Understanding the Olsen Growth Chart

The Olsen growth chart is a specialized tool reflecting unique growth patterns in specific populations, such as preterm infants. It addresses the limitations of standard growth charts, which are based on data from full-term children and may not accurately represent these specific groups. For instance, the Olsen 2010 growth charts report percentiles and Z-scores for preterm infants from 23 to 41 weeks gestational age, covering weight, length, and head circumference.

Specialized charts like Olsen’s are necessary because average growth velocity, stature, and weight in certain populations differ significantly from the general population. Preterm infants, for example, have distinct growth trajectories due to their early birth. Using standard charts for these children could lead to misinterpretations of their health status. The Olsen chart provides a more appropriate reference for assessing infant growth.

The Olsen intrauterine growth curves for preterm infants include weight, length, and head circumference for gestational age. These measurements are plotted over time to visually represent a child’s growth. The data used to construct these charts often comes from large samples of specific populations, such as US birth data from 1998-2006.

Interpreting Growth Patterns

Interpreting growth patterns on the Olsen chart involves plotting a child’s measurements and observing their trajectory relative to percentile lines. These lines represent the distribution of measurements within the reference population, such as the 3rd, 50th, and 97th percentiles for weight, length, and head circumference for preterm infants. For example, a child consistently growing along the 50th percentile means their measurements are at the average for children of the same age and sex within the chart’s specific population.

A “normal” growth trajectory on the Olsen chart, for populations like preterm infants, generally shows a steady progression along or parallel to a particular percentile curve. This indicates consistent growth in line with what is expected for their gestational age and sex. Deviations from this pattern can signal potential health concerns.

A sudden drop in percentile, for instance, might suggest growth faltering or an underlying medical issue affecting nutrient absorption or metabolism. Conversely, a sharp increase in percentile or excessive weight gain could indicate over-nutrition or other health conditions. In such cases, consulting a healthcare professional is important for further evaluation and intervention. The growth pattern, rather than a single measurement, provides a comprehensive understanding of a child’s health and nutritional status.

Importance of Specialized Growth Charts

Specialized growth charts, like the Olsen chart, are important because standard charts are often not appropriate for monitoring specific populations. Standard charts are typically derived from data on healthy, full-term children, and applying them to populations with different physiological characteristics can lead to misinterpretations. For example, children with Down syndrome exhibit different growth patterns compared to the general population, including differences in mean birth weight, length, and the age at which final height is reached.

Using standard growth charts for these children can inaccurately classify their growth as abnormal, potentially leading to unnecessary medical investigations or interventions. If a child with Down syndrome is plotted on a standard chart, their naturally lower average height might appear concerning when it is typical for their condition. This highlights how specialized charts provide a more accurate and realistic reference for growth assessment.

The Olsen chart and similar tools help healthcare providers monitor health, identify potential medical conditions, and provide appropriate interventions. For children with Down syndrome, specific growth charts can aid in the early detection of conditions like thyroid issues or celiac disease, which can further impact growth. By offering a tailored reference, these charts support timely and targeted nutritional or medical management, contributing to optimal health outcomes and improved developmental support for these children.
